diff options
author | 2014-12-14 22:30:20 +0000 | |
---|---|---|
committer | 2014-12-14 22:30:20 +0000 | |
commit | b188ab4e1624a1d699cd79b9ffb6f5bec65cd305 (patch) | |
tree | 3b186cf16195d5cda966011a4790f445adc8b493 /app-accessibility/sphinx3 | |
parent | Version bump for Gnome 3.14. (diff) | |
download | historical-b188ab4e1624a1d699cd79b9ffb6f5bec65cd305.tar.gz historical-b188ab4e1624a1d699cd79b9ffb6f5bec65cd305.tar.bz2 historical-b188ab4e1624a1d699cd79b9ffb6f5bec65cd305.zip |
Convert to distutils-r1.
Package-Manager: portage-2.2.15/cvs/Linux x86_64
Manifest-Sign-Key: 0xEFB4464E!
Diffstat (limited to 'app-accessibility/sphinx3')
-rw-r--r-- | app-accessibility/sphinx3/ChangeLog | 10 | ||||
-rw-r--r-- | app-accessibility/sphinx3/Manifest | 27 | ||||
-rw-r--r-- | app-accessibility/sphinx3/sphinx3-0.8-r1.ebuild | 61 |
3 files changed, 86 insertions, 12 deletions
diff --git a/app-accessibility/sphinx3/ChangeLog b/app-accessibility/sphinx3/ChangeLog index eb1fe1cd09f1..4ed72116b66f 100644 --- a/app-accessibility/sphinx3/ChangeLog +++ b/app-accessibility/sphinx3/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for app-accessibility/sphinx3 -# Copyright 1999-2013 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/app-accessibility/sphinx3/ChangeLog,v 1.10 2013/10/09 02:03:56 teiresias Exp $ +#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/app-accessibility/sphinx3/ChangeLog,v 1.11 2014/12/14 22:30:18 mgorny Exp $ + +*sphinx3-0.8-r1 (14 Dec 2014) + + 14 Dec 2014; Michał Górny <mgorny@gentoo.org> +sphinx3-0.8-r1.ebuild: + Convert to distutils-r1. 09 Oct 2013; Christopher Brannon <teiresias@gentoo.org> sphinx3-0.8.ebuild, +files/sphinx3-0.8-libutil.patch: @@ -42,4 +47,3 @@ Remove include of nonexistent header. Closes bug #487098. +sphinx3-0.6.ebuild: Initial import, bug #129149 with help from Franklin Marmon <marmon@montana.com>. - diff --git a/app-accessibility/sphinx3/Manifest b/app-accessibility/sphinx3/Manifest index 13721a0cf5be..985e9122033c 100644 --- a/app-accessibility/sphinx3/Manifest +++ b/app-accessibility/sphinx3/Manifest @@ -6,17 +6,26 @@ AUX sphinx3-0.8_heap_fix.patch 1475 SHA256 ade4d1bf57eeb4a182d917bf33ada2e9f681d DIST sphinx3-0.6.3.tar.gz 26070353 SHA256 f6a070a67d91ccd00dbce7b6cc55242ed7a5ebaae6d6429eb0364657c4056ede SHA512 2f784459a18692594c0834dac1ee814eb663cca1e4b2906d31915f1e518efc83e760f5ae1a15d3b274a8e8e0ffbc43e56bb338f098a8abc304429b4d8262c11e WHIRLPOOL 4ba83a919a57f2c80450fe9b110179403e7e02adc930e749f7c331d393e71ce798cf194a768db7a735a9bc9879bd31294e471f34abc89ab8caa9bde404d2a84f DIST sphinx3-0.8.tar.gz 25226326 SHA256 1cf76a086f9b509e35f7226df2e61b0a0bf8b0858b9676e5b18cfc47b2ea2741 SHA512 85b8e574e2f92a758c8c56ef11b873c49ef8a376e964f30a12d75850d4a0db56e3108eaea25fa5587675ef2ffa4531a13f0f182a85cc8e434c6bcee42058e050 WHIRLPOOL 0f3604b4fa320f59e4ee65b79c4a779c48f2822a944b28b85a740826244f5eb7adc072538919c97ebf4eb270660fbe6f5b30b55cc67ec6276358063cf340aa7b EBUILD sphinx3-0.6.3.ebuild 597 SHA256 6a81fb09300563484b973765f9e174160f64eb4ec427119289e74477d9d8637d SHA512 169249ab76358b5e81d32f1ad4003edd03ce6c1f3abab36ba485c08f64c13346566d57d3c7bb53fae5c7b2cda3313817b09725dc8853a7c7bb929cd613ff2491 WHIRLPOOL f683b5d407578e67a98b887f03d18b61384b6c3b22563834c9e852ebb6bbe4daf744eceb4a3cab8c35aaa1a0660fa6b2c1a0185a073b046b490ff0d53e46bf0a +EBUILD sphinx3-0.8-r1.ebuild 1360 SHA256 24a0112a047f036b8f5b67454c60a40b4cbf1fcfc83a8f49302636bb226a606c SHA512 16a00e12c25f4fdd45bcbb55002537e6d0f8eee74d727753a737d94dd6654f46eed385ac7069534005b39293dca7ddfd2213701360db7e09b80e1cd3f84a942d WHIRLPOOL 5646bb3e0fac11961113c83a77a00b22dc4884eed4b0185ebd08ddafd815df270c2d795a6b6a5e689f4dc2819fcabe533a4f3e91d12c10e69b616070937b4991 EBUILD sphinx3-0.8.ebuild 1435 SHA256 15ae2807988426b07ed5ca48ffde8b0ec9c6c676621bd033375953c674bd8473 SHA512 ad413de84e9ca010342b8e3f59065268dc2230869ea19095d1ebeb61e20835304de1812636335363506868ae9dacb3c0e27e4edc7941993a896201c3265204bc WHIRLPOOL 8d784145c8aae341443d43e0ca5eb57f52f510cb2452f0d1a217381afea3caa9b15585b02b9b4c0bb65ae3be23832946c21a57ccadaead465fb04d616e05bb80 -MISC ChangeLog 1558 SHA256 b3f1f7426f830ac48cbdf1a93dc1c4d4f2db708ee5c595f3f8dc40747110586a SHA512 d9ec29e204e67f23c53f46bc0e09dc0accf080c1f55623b5042823ca8e15b584b17c5ece9da85b5ebe5fa109bfa2c9d669e26fbd1b89068f23600cac80f20199 WHIRLPOOL 178464e57b36ef5a77d1d218ec7ddfbcc48a87048b4326d219ab5b9fe4788a6722d4c5de50caabd066c0e9d0361052d686c5675a67fa2d1c35ffaca9bf2d3dd5 +MISC ChangeLog 1687 SHA256 64574cc54f2954fe8ff45856fe1d0e9656e51ec1937d5202e87cd55c2c5eab76 SHA512 f4968080d6c55463e8c8871403f0149dd90768df72a5f8d5a1c4fe02a1f78c3a51040c1dae1c48d80bf4ae2117c2f080e8377f3023b252c270b76ac10af40da4 WHIRLPOOL c1619902a47fd3b8b2d51aad150d83818b9fb747806b0893554a80dcb788a6234134016b5a1a6176d67473708b9db87f1c2aedf88922bbef4846058f825048c3 MISC metadata.xml 166 SHA256 b405a4d46651e139c00ec6b19acf7bb3cd23456275250b6de43951b7559a0b21 SHA512 8a7e8613b02ba13a11e395dce1cb0d785b7e4fe08d83e71fbf3865625952e37794296d1eeeadf5d606109f9abeb269430e24cf3152533bc265612dd730b46db9 WHIRLPOOL f266bc06e2d9fad75d1778157e1868cd6cc9542d74e9cd4847cef0fde8e5d4b8b8c83c62d6e1cd5702271dab9fcd7c326bef23d7b6d7a9e63042a280194d2d4b -----BEGIN PGP SIGNATURE----- -Version: GnuPG v2.0.20 (GNU/Linux) +Version: GnuPG v2 -iQEcBAEBCAAGBQJSVLmRAAoJEH8qFnJlIeBttc4H/RAiDihRZRHAubSDzW8kyX8L -glmao8OlGwDSDDzxb0ViMT6J/eLlkTTuY1u9t/leWdBCD24ClL3VnQeak6Vm2gT/ -hlOs9FHDXpO0HxIoTnJQ1dJ3L3nV1KbjYm9QgSJLRO5yvmilQNKjqQQ4W1fmiek6 -CzOcuxrRg9snU2FKpk1WxYvuA5rYD7FmuuoAktewjSFFCgkDw/hDHwfKX2Awboe4 -X5F20U7YL8eVKaMbJ6k78kn1eT37Ssfb+8v1DZSvF+y6W1VnUGYvz5Hpt0D7plEI -D/R3j7znJgxpA/DVi0jFdIM1ZzhakldzUcusZULUhnlgFPe7Msy+WGd5Ppe5ABw= -=a2dO +iQJ8BAEBCABmBQJUjg97Xx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w +ZW5wZ3AuZmlmdGhob3JzZW1hbi5uZXQ2REJCMDdDQzRGMERBRDA2RUEwQUZFNDFC +MDdBMUFFQUVGQjQ0NjRFAAoJELB6GurvtEZOmKwP/ip98A4jQRAf/XySba1fGx17 +vh5/x27kIR8toiDCuvsuZDrfjSnYjYCkEPEYcc0c1yIiDz9wAXghvtWiJ9BkNe0f +7K6N0LE+fCgd4YQSuZkSBX7EsNK3VxvdvNPx2cI/RJZvU49KLIpIZ0AF8yCLI20Q +qz2UCsUPRoFWCDlsRnMKE2skKgs7YhvaqZv7j+iUc0FKaYzbTzDyDHMOZdNPeV1M +uVgz0nocmqIhObyNk3MCbJGrU2fv5QSABRMbdPt/16Rr0+DvxptlTYaH0gUMw4TF +VE9c8ggwaOzaYO7jBFJOFyIFrQullbhyJEsmrZCTWWveB49PUD5YauyQPn4LDZzI +HruSZEfCyitG1lTKB5Rl6bsKN+FjhUNB0lDVm4bQr3BnOcUL6ZEMx3tcjd2ZvF19 +jFpE8pvvfZmR96V0qGhCuVhLQ0q3MCyjglmn8HdzTipuRt874pJIKwWERr6bLRZE +Ip9j2lOELgB6dPJ80PrdMkVrst6/0/JKTBIAHYFWHaDPbDk2xT5jPUnuTcObiiLZ +6ineIvrM7k+krlZy97pHOTz6eVYtxnLE1xAqddZwrkCAGdYP229CYWQrYd1D1SBx +2Ix6eo5cU7jHmRMcS8wYaq4PiMwcVrfGxBYtXsIBby1DrQOYdzLdTlUsTUGVPCN7 +VMajDCi93uvdHH/K3exO +=KoIU -----END PGP SIGNATURE----- diff --git a/app-accessibility/sphinx3/sphinx3-0.8-r1.ebuild b/app-accessibility/sphinx3/sphinx3-0.8-r1.ebuild new file mode 100644 index 000000000000..bc7dc486c298 --- /dev/null +++ b/app-accessibility/sphinx3/sphinx3-0.8-r1.ebuild @@ -0,0 +1,61 @@ +# Copyright 1999-2014 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/app-accessibility/sphinx3/sphinx3-0.8-r1.ebuild,v 1.1 2014/12/14 22:30:18 mgorny Exp $ + +EAPI=5 + +# disable automatic phase exports and deps +DISTUTILS_OPTIONAL=1 +PYTHON_COMPAT=( python2_7 ) + +inherit autotools-utils distutils-r1 prefix eutils + +DESCRIPTION="CMU Speech Recognition engine" +HOMEPAGE="http://cmusphinx.sourceforge.net/" +SRC_URI="mirror://sourceforge/cmusphinx/${P}.tar.gz" + +LICENSE="BSD-2" +SLOT="0" +KEYWORDS="~amd64 ~x86" +IUSE="doc python static-libs" + +RDEPEND=">=app-accessibility/sphinxbase-0.7[static-libs?,python?,${PYTHON_USEDEP}] + python? ( ${PYTHON_DEPS} )" +DEPEND="${RDEPEND}" + +REQUIRED_USE="python? ( ${PYTHON_REQUIRED_USE} )" + +# Due to generated Python setup.py. +AUTOTOOLS_IN_SOURCE_BUILD=1 + +src_prepare() { + epatch "${FILESDIR}/${P}_heap_fix.patch" \ + "${FILESDIR}/${P}-libutil.patch" + eprefixify 'python/setup.py' +} + +src_compile() { + autotools-utils_src_compile + + if use python; then + cd python || die + distutils-r1_src_compile + fi +} + +src_install() { + local DOCS=( AUTHORS ChangeLog NEWS README ) + autotools-utils_src_install + + if use doc; then + cd doc || die + dohtml -r -x CVS s3* s3 *.html + fi + + if use python; then + unset DOCS + + cd "${S}"/python || die + distutils-r1_src_install + fi +} |